One-Wire Transmission
The first to be demonstrated was the operation of light and motive devices connected by a single wire to only one terminal of the high frequency coil, presented in the 1891 lecture EXPERIMENTS WITH ALTERNATE CURRENTS OF VERY HIGH FREQUENCY AND THEIR APPLICATION TO METHODS OF ARTIFICIAL ILLUMINATION (Developments, Reports and Web log away from Nikola Tesla, pp. 156-172; Nikola Tesla On the Their Work with Changing Currents as well as their Software so you’re able to Wireless Telegraphy, Telephony, and you may Alert out of Power, p. 7).
